Often measured by GDP (gross domestic product), the size of an economy is often defined by the total value of all the goods and services produced the borders of a given country. This gives us a nice, ...
Millions of Hindus are gathering in a northern Indian city for the Maha Kumbh festival, the world’s largest religious congregation ...